William Reeves, London, [n.d.]. Facsimile Edition. Hardcover (Original Cloth). Very Good Condition/Good. Book . VG+ HB in G DJ, protected by mylar cover. xii, 390 p.+48 p. catalog: ill.; 22 cm. Facsimile reprint (c. 1951) of 1864 original issue. Includes 48 p. catalog of Reeves music titles, the most recent of which is dated 1951. Maroon coth with bright copper title on spine. Book has slight wear at the bottom of the spine and corners. DJ has wear at the outside edges of the folds with some chipping at the top and bottom of the spine. Standard source on the topic, esp. English makers. Size: Octavo (8vo; up to 9 3/4" / 20-25 cm tall). Item Type: Book. Quantity Available: 1. Category: MUSIC; Musical Instruments / Strings; .
